Output f21836a5ed8b582f8e1876e7e99d4894b0d64d9a90b2902e54d68f55f1bc2541:1

value
43059000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cc2272e53d83c329623920fd85eef32163031f3 OP_EQUAL
address
MNC2EM2q8J2R5CaXyZQARSpCmGfJD9iPRA
transaction
f21836a5ed8b582f8e1876e7e99d4894b0d64d9a90b2902e54d68f55f1bc2541
spent
true